English Royal Correspondence 1546

Download this episode (18 min)   

Letters in Latin from Prince Edward to Henry VIII, his father, to his stepmother, to Princess Mary and Princess Elizabeth. A letter to Cranmer. A letter from Princess Elizabeth to King Edward VI.
Letters of consolation after the death of Henry VIII written by Edward VI.
These were written when Edward was nine years old.
